Requested Action
MOTION TO ADOPT Resolution No. 2018-385 of the Board of County Commissioners of Broward County, Florida, directing the County Administrator to publish a Notice of Public Hearing to be held on Tuesday, October 23, 2018, at 10:00 am., in Room 422, Broward County Governmental Center, for the purpose of receiving public input on the proposed implementation of new limited-stop fixed-route bus service along Broward Boulevard between the City of Sunrise and Downtown Fort Lauderdale to be known as "Broward Breeze"; and providing for an effective date. 

ACTION:  (T-1:46 PM)  Approved.
 
VOTE: 9-0.
Why Action is Necessary
In accordance with FTA and County policies, a public hearing is required (1) prior to the establishment of a new transit route or (2) when proposing permanent fixed-route frequency changes greater than ten minutes during peak hours or more than 20 minutes in off-peak hours.
What Action Accomplishes
Schedules Public Hearing to receive public input on proposed new "Broward Breeze" fixed-route bus service along Broward Boulevard between the City of Sunrise and Downtown Fort Lauderdale, planned to begin in January 2019.

In compliance with federal and county regulations, policies and procedures, a public hearing will allow public comment on the proposed new "Broward Breeze" limited-stop fixed-route bus service. 

The Transit Division is proposing the addition of limited-stop fixed-route bus service along Broward Boulevard. This new "Broward Breeze" service will travel westbound and eastbound, giving customers access to employment, education and medical centers, transit facilities, government centers, and entertainment venues in Sunrise, Plantation, and downtown Fort Lauderdale. The Broward Breeze will operate every 30 minutes on weekdays during peak morning (from 5:40 a.m. to 10:16 a.m.) and afternoon (4:05 p.m. to 8:46 p.m.) travel times. Forty-two-foot Bus Rapid Transit (BRT) style vehicles equipped with Wi-Fi will be utilized for the service which will begin operation in January 2019. Exhibit 3 is the route map. The service is being funded through a Florida Department of Transportation (FDOT) grant.

Advance public notice of the time and date of the public hearing on the proposed new Breeze service will be accomplished using the newspaper; Broward County’s website and Facebook page; all BCT buses; notices posted at major employment centers along the route; customer service/rider information “on-hold” voice messaging system; community meetings, and; notices posted at major transit facilities.
